About The Book

<p>Caregiving is a challenging job whether you're taking care of an aging parent disabled child or a sick spouse. It can be rewarding to help improve someone's life but it can also be draining and isolating. Full-time caregivers in particular face a unique set of challenges often alone including financial strain constant worry and a lack of social interaction. These challenges can lead to feelings of loneliness. abandonment and depression. </p><p>This guide illuminates the often-overlooked emotions and challenges faced by full-time caregivers. This guide delves into the emotional turmoil experienced particularly loneliness. abandonment and depression the stigma surrounding mental health needs and the daily obstacles they encounter.Importantly are highlighted the necessity of self-care and the advantages of cultivating a strong support system. Recognizing the invaluable role caregivers play in our communities-through their personal sacrifices and the profound impact they have on their loved ones' lives-is crucial. </p><p>The insights shared in this guide aim to empower caregivers to confront their emotional struggles and prioritize their mental wellness. I trust that the information provided will serve as a valuable resource helping caregivers adopt a mindful approach to combat feelings of loneliness abandonment and depression while fostering supportive communities. In doing so caregivers can enhance their well-being and provide even better care. I aspire for this guide to contribute to a healthier more supportive environment for all caregivers.</p>
